Levulinic acid, 98+%
Manufacturer:
ACROS ORGANI
Item Number:
125140010
Product Name:
Levulinic acid, 98+%
Specifications:
1KG
CAS No.:
123-76-2
Catalog No.:
125140010
Privacy Preference Center
Manage Consent Settings
Necessary Cookies